How much do full time life insurance customer service j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for full time life insurance customer service in the United States is $18.80,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$20.91 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Why do most life insurance agents quit?

Most life insurance agents quit due to high competition, inconsistent commissions, and the challenging nature of building a client base. The job often requires strong sales skills, persistence, and resilience, which can lead to burnout and turnover if expectations are not managed properly.

What is the highest paid customer service job?

In customer service roles, senior management positions such as Customer Service Directors or Customer Experience Managers tend to have the highest salaries, often exceeding six figures with experience and industry specialization. Specialized roles in technical support or sales within customer service can also command higher pay, especially in industries like technology or finance.

Can I work from home as a life insurance agent?

Full Time Life Insurance Customer Service roles can often be performed remotely, especially with the use of digital communication tools and customer management software. Many companies offer work-from-home options for agents, but specific policies depend on the employer and job requirements, such as licensing and training.

What life insurance company has the highest paid agents?

In the field of full-time life insurance customer service, agent compensation varies by company, with some large insurers like Northwestern Mutual, New York Life, and MassMutual known for offering competitive salaries and bonuses. High earnings often depend on experience, sales performance, and certifications, with top agents earning substantial commissions and incentives. Compensation structures typically include base pay plus performance-based bonuses, making some companies more lucrative for successful agents.

What is the difference between Full Time Life Insurance Customer Service vs Part Time Life Insurance Customer Service?

AspectFull Time Life Insurance Customer ServicePart Time Life Insurance Customer Service
Work HoursTypically 35-40 hours per weekLess than 30 hours per week
CredentialsRequires similar certifications, such as insurance licensesSame certifications required, but may have more flexible scheduling
Work EnvironmentOffice setting or remote, structured scheduleFlexible hours, possibly remote or part-time office
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in insurance companies, customer service centersUsed by same employers, catering to part-time or flexible staffing needs

Full Time Life Insurance Customer Service involves standard full-time hours with consistent schedules, while Part Time roles offer more flexibility with fewer hours. Both roles require similar credentials and are used within the same industry and employer settings, but differ mainly in hours and scheduling flexibility.
